[QUOTE="GTNavyNuke, post: 803843, member: 322"] I think that while Hall may have the final say on recruits, the pitching coach has a very large input. Thus the previous pitching coaches provided input on who to take. DBo became our pitching coach on 19 August 2019. So his first class is coming in this year. I think we had the reputation of not developing pitchers as well as other colleges so that greatly limited our choices. Plus we used to mostly stay in state which reduces the selection (whether that was intentional or a result I don't know). [B]I think we should give DBo a pass on the continuing pitching mess until next season and expect pitching to get noticeably better (by ERA / WHIP / SO ratio). [/B] He hasn't had the time to develop the players given the remote aspects due to COVID and the facility was just finished this year. I'll be doing an overall pitching post this week (I hope) as improved pitching is the last link in our team going to the next level. [/QUOTE]
